Key Tips For Smooth And Creamy Cheesecake

  • Prevent Cracking Creatively: Use a water bath by placing the springform pan in a larger baking dish filled with hot water to create moisture and prevent surface cracks during baking.
  • Beat Smoothly Strategically: Ensure cream cheese is at room temperature and beat on low speed to minimize air incorporation, which helps prevent cheesecake from rising and falling unevenly.
  • Crust Compression Technique: Press graham cracker mixture firmly and evenly into the pan's bottom using the back of a measuring cup for a compact, uniform base that won't crumble.
  • Cooling Carefully: Allow cheesecake to cool gradually at room temperature before refrigerating to prevent sudden temperature changes that can cause surface cracking or uneven texture.

How To Store Blueberry Cheesecake Just Right

  • Store the blueberry cheesecake in an airtight container or cover tightly with plastic wrap to prevent moisture loss and absorbing other food odors. Keep refrigerated for up to 5 days.
  • Wrap the cheesecake securely in plastic wrap, then place inside a freezer-safe container or heavy-duty freezer bag. Freeze for maximum 1-2 months without compromising taste or texture.
  • Before storing, place parchment paper between individual slices to prevent sticking and maintain the cheesecake's pristine appearance when separating portions.
  • Allow the cheesecake to sit at room temperature for 15-20 minutes before serving to soften slightly and enhance flavor profile, but do not leave out for extended periods.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ients:

  • 2 cups graham cracker crumbs
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ter
  • 24 oz cream cheese
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1/4 cup sour cream
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ract

Blueberry Topping:

  • 2 cups fresh blueberries
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 tbsp lemon juice
  • 1 tbsp cornstarch

Garnish:

  • 1/2 cup whipped cream
  • 1/4 cup fresh blueberries
  • 1 mint sprig (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 325°F and prepare a 9-inch springform pan by lining the bottom with parchment paper.
  2. Melt butter and mix thoroughly with graham cracker crumbs until uniformly moistened, then press mixture firmly into pan’s bottom to create a compact crust.
  3. In a large mixing bowl, blend cream cheese and sugar until smooth and creamy, ensuring no lumps remain.
  4. Incorporate eggs one at a time, mixing gently after each addition to maintain a silky texture.
  5. Fold in sour cream and vanilla extract, stirring until ingredients are completely integrated.
  6. Pour cheesecake batter over prepared crust, smoothing the surface with a spatula for even distribution.
  7. Bake for 55-60 minutes, watching for slight jiggle in center while edges appear set.
  8. Remove from oven and allow to cool completely at room temperature, then refrigerate for minimum 4 hours.
  9. For blueberry topping, combine blueberries, sugar, lemon juice, and cornstarch in a saucepan over medium heat.
  10. Simmer mixture for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ally until sauce thickens and berries begin to break down.
  11. Cool blueberry sauce completely before spreading over chilled cheesecake.
  12. Garnish with dollops of whipped cream, fresh blueberries, and optional mint sprig before serving.

Notes

  • Prevent Crust Crumbling by thoroughly mixing melted butter with graham cracker crumbs and pressing firmly into the pan, creating a solid base that holds together perfectly when sliced.
  • Smooth Cream Cheese Mixture by bringing cream cheese to room temperature beforehand and using an electric mixer to eliminate any potential lumps, ensuring a silky-smooth texture.
  • Avoid Cheesecake Cracking by baking in a water bath or placing a pan of water on the lower oven rack, which helps create consistent humidity and prevents surface splitting.
